Matrix upgrades can leave config in a state that blocks reinstall/repair, and plugin runtime version reporting can disagree with the actual OpenClaw version.

Closes #52899

Changes:

  • Change plugin runtime version exposure to use the shared version resolver instead of reading package.json directly so plugin compatibility checks report the same runtime version as the CLI/update path.
  • Allow repair-oriented plugin install flow to proceed from an invalid config snapshot for plugins install, using best-effort config instead of hard-failing in preflight.
  • During doctor repair and/or Matrix plugin reinstall, remove stale Matrix plugin load-path/install references left by the old bundled-plugin layout so the rewritten config becomes valid again.
  • Add regression coverage for invalid-config Matrix reinstall, doctor cleanup of stale Matrix plugin refs, and runtime version exposure used by plugin compatibility checks.

1. 🔵 Prototype pollution via object spread in removePluginFromConfig when processing user-controlled config

Property Value
Severity Low
CWE CWE-1321
Location src/plugins/uninstall.ts:77-161

Description

removePluginFromConfig() constructs new config objects using object spread over values derived from the on-disk config file (JSON5). If a malicious config contains a __proto__ key (or similar special keys), spreading it into a new object can mutate the prototype of the created object, leading to prototype pollution.

This is now more reachable because the new Matrix “stale config cleanup” path calls removePluginFromConfig(cfg,"matrix") during doctor/install flows, which can execute on invalid-but-parseable configs.

Vulnerable code (object spread over untrusted object):

const pluginsConfig = cfg.plugins ?? {};
...
const newPlugins = {
  ...pluginsConfig,
  entries,
  installs,
  allow,
  load,
  slots,
};
...
const config: OpenClawConfig = {
  ...cfg,
  plugins: Object.keys(cleanedPlugins).length > 0 ? cleanedPlugins : undefined,
};

Impact depends on how polluted objects are later used, but typical risks include:

  • Unexpected property lookups succeeding via polluted prototype (e.g., if (obj.admin) style checks)
  • Crashes/DoS due to surprising inherited properties
  • Bypassing logic that assumes plain objects

Recommendation

Avoid spreading/assigning untrusted objects into plain {} targets. Instead, create “plain” objects with a null prototype and copy only expected keys.

Example fix:

function pickPluginsConfig(input: unknown) {
  const out: Record<string, unknown> = Object.create(null);
  if (!input || typeof input !== "object") return out;
  const obj = input as Record<string, unknown>;// Copy only known-safe keys
  for (const key of ["entries", "installs", "allow", "load", "slots"]) {
    if (Object.prototype.hasOwnProperty.call(obj, key)) out[key] = obj[key];
  }
  return out as any;
}

const pluginsConfig = pickPluginsConfig(cfg.plugins);
const newPlugins = Object.assign(Object.create(null), pluginsConfig, {
  entries,
  installs,
  allow,
  load,
  slots,
});

const config = Object.assign(Object.create(null), cfg, {
  plugins: Object.keys(cleanedPlugins).length > 0 ? cleanedPlugins : undefined,
});

Additionally, consider rejecting configs containing __proto__, constructor, or prototype keys during parsing/validation.


2. 🔵 Terminal escape/log injection via untrusted filesystem path in doctor notes

Property Value
Severity Low
CWE CWE-117
Location src/commands/doctor/providers/matrix.ts:106-112

Description

cleanStaleMatrixPluginConfig() builds a human-readable change message that includes issue.path, which ultimately comes from cfg.plugins.installs.matrix (config-controlled) via detectPluginInstallPathIssue().

  • Input (attacker-controlled): install.sourcePath / install.installPath from config file
  • Propagation: detectPluginInstallPathIssue() returns path: candidatePath without sanitization
  • Sink: message is printed to the terminal using note() / @​clack/prompts with no escaping/neutralization of control characters

An attacker who can influence the config (or a synced/shared config) could embed control characters (e.g., ANSI escape sequences, newlines, carriage returns) in the path value. When openclaw doctor runs, the output could be manipulated to:

  • Spoof additional log lines / alter the appearance of warnings (log forging)
  • Hide/overwrite terminal output (ANSI injection)
  • Phish the operator by rendering deceptive prompts/commands

Vulnerable code:

changes: [
  `Removed stale Matrix plugin references (${removed.join(", ")}). ` +
    `The previous install path no longer exists: ${issue.path}`,
],

and the note sink:

clackNote(wrapNoteMessage(message), stylePromptTitle(title));

No output neutralization is performed to remove control characters from interpolated values.

Recommendation

Neutralize control characters before writing untrusted values to terminal/log output.

Options:

  1. Sanitize just the interpolated path (recommended minimal fix):
function sanitizeForTerminal(value: string): string {// Strip C0/C1 control chars and ESC (\u001b) used for ANSI sequences.
  return value.replace(/[\u0000-\u001F\u007F-\u009F\u001B]/g, "");
}// ...
`The previous install path no longer exists: ${sanitizeForTerminal(issue.path)}`
  1. Centralize sanitization in note() so all notes are protected:
export function note(message: string, title?: string) {
  if (isSuppressedByEnv(process.env.OPENCLAW_SUPPRESS_NOTES)) return;
  const safe = message.replace(/[\u0000-\u001F\u007F-\u009F\u001B]/g, "");
  clackNote(wrapNoteMessage(safe), stylePromptTitle(title));
}

Also consider shortening or redacting home directories (e.g., ~/...) if doctor output is commonly shared in issue reports to reduce accidental path disclosure.

P1 Badge Restrict fallback recovery to Matrix stale-path invalid configs

loadConfigForInstall now swallows every INVALID_CONFIG error and proceeds, which means plugins install can run download/copy installers even when the config is invalid for unrelated reasons (for example schema mismatches outside Matrix). In that case the command only fails later during writeConfigFile validation, after filesystem side effects have already happened, leaving partially installed plugin directories from a failed install attempt. Please gate this fallback to the specific stale-Matrix-path case (or revalidate before running installers).

P1 Badge Remove stale Matrix load paths when sourcePath is missing

This cleanup delegates to removePluginFromConfig, but that helper only removes plugins.load.paths via install.sourcePath; if a stale source: "path" install record has only installPath (which the type allows), detectPluginInstallPathIssue will still report missing-path while the stale load path survives. The resulting config remains invalid, so the intended reinstall/doctor recovery path can still fail to persist.

Greptile Summary

This PR fixes two related Matrix upgrade recovery issues: stale plugin install records that block config validation, and plugin runtime version reporting that could disagree with the CLI's own version string.

Key changes:

  • src/plugins/runtime/index.ts: Replaces the createRequire/package.json-based resolveVersion() with the shared VERSION constant, eliminating API-version drift between plugin compatibility checks and the CLI.
  • src/cli/plugins-install-command.ts: New loadConfigForInstall() catches INVALID_CONFIG errors from loadConfig(), falls back to the raw config snapshot, and guards against empty-parse scenarios to avoid overwriting user config with an empty stub. Stale Matrix refs are cleaned as a side-effect of any successful install.
  • src/cli/program/config-guard.ts: plugins install is added to ALLOWED_INVALID_PLUGINS_SUBCOMMANDS so the config-guard preflight no longer exits early when the config is invalid.
  • src/commands/doctor/providers/matrix.ts: New cleanStaleMatrixPluginConfig() detects a missing-path install issue and delegates removal to removePluginFromConfig, correctly clearing the install record, load path, plugin entry, and allowlist entry.
  • src/commands/doctor-config-flow.ts: Runs the stale Matrix cleanup in the doctor flow, following the established applyDoctorConfigMutation pattern.
  • Test coverage is thorough: edge cases for empty-parse fallback, non-config errors, happy-path cleanup, and the new VERSION exposure are all covered.
